Phone cottage owners to find out more about whether pets can be left alone for any period of time; some may have a pen or kennels. They will also be able to let you know about good walks and beaches where dogs are permitted. Dogs are banned from many family friendly beaches during the May - September period. There are always the coastal paths where dogs can walk happily and many other locations.
